supervette64 01-29-2024 02:54 PM

Agreed - $500 on the low end but running - $1000 for a desirable year and in pretty good shape (roller block). I had a guy offer to sell me his for $4500 which is WILD considering I bought an LS3 for less than that.

The hard part for selling is there aren't many people who want one - because why would you buy a 240hp engine these days. Its mostly only people like us who are racing in a series/class that dictate a stock/period correct engine.
